diff options
author | Anton Kling <anton@kling.gg> | 2024-06-23 12:42:37 +0200 |
---|---|---|
committer | Anton Kling <anton@kling.gg> | 2024-06-23 12:42:56 +0200 |
commit | eb606d798b18be08e4a403132350b6dc350b522b (patch) | |
tree | db4aa1e6ec799f9d5bf4bd8c9b71ed0dc45bedad /userland/test/test.c | |
parent | 5fbd9b519e082fc235a8a57c6cf761e6cefbfb62 (diff) |
LibC: Include delim in getdelim if it was seen
Diffstat (limited to 'userland/test/test.c')
-rw-r--r-- | userland/test/test.c |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/userland/test/test.c b/userland/test/test.c index 28e84d9..9013f1e 100644 --- a/userland/test/test.c +++ b/userland/test/test.c @@ -723,15 +723,16 @@ void getline_test(void) { size_t n; n = 256; getline(&line_buffer, &n, fp); - assert(0 == strcmp("line1", line_buffer)); + assert(0 == strcmp("line1\n", line_buffer)); n = 256; getline(&line_buffer, &n, fp); - assert(0 == strcmp("line2", line_buffer)); + assert(0 == strcmp("line2\n", line_buffer)); n = 256; getline(&line_buffer, &n, fp); - assert(0 == strcmp("foo", line_buffer)); + assert(0 == strcmp("foo\n", line_buffer)); n = 256; getline(&line_buffer, &n, fp); + printf("line_buffer: %s\n", line_buffer); assert(0 == strcmp("bar", line_buffer)); } free(buffer); |